What is EMP Museum?
EMP Museum operates as a premier nonprofit institution dedicated to the exploration of risk-taking and creative expression within popular culture. By leveraging its foundational roots in rock 'n' roll, the organization has evolved into a multifaceted gateway museum. It utilizes advanced interactive technologies to bridge the gap between historical artifacts and contemporary audiences, fostering a multigenerational dialogue.
